Hi Al,
>Adding a call to DisplayErrors works. I like working exclusively with the entities and I thought it would be nice if the SaveEntity method would complete the cycle. But for now, I'll probably stick with the page Save method.
>
Your welcome, glad you got it going. Remember though that displaying a message to the user is a UI thing and not a business object task. That is why the DisplayError is written in the base for the page class. Also, a business object or entity should not know anything about your UI implementation. I suppose it would be possible for Kevin to raise an event at the business level to notify any subscribers (UI) that a business rule was broken, but in this case the pages Save() is there for that purpose.
Tim
Timothy Bryan